Mine is about 3-3.5 feet deep with koi. My koi are about 6-7 years old and about 2 feet . Havent lost any in a few years with this set up. Anywhere in that range you can have the fish winter over. I would look into getting a really good filter system . Thats where people cheap out and they always come back to the store with issues. We sell the liner from firestone, it has a 20+ warrentee on it . We carry a underliner as well that you place under the liner to help protect roots from puncturing holes.
